Ravi Shastri names India's XI for 1st T20I vs South Africa

Shastri didn't pick in-form Dinesh Karthik in his selected XI for the first T20I to be played in Delhi.

Former head coach Ravi Shastri has picked India’s best XI for the first T20I against South Africa that will be played at the Arun Jaitley Stadium in New Delhi on June 9.  However, the cricketer-turned-commentator has made a couple of exclusions one of which indeed happens to be a surprising one. Batting all-rounder Venkatesh Iyer found no place in his list, but more importantly, an in-form Dinesh Karthik has been excluded as well.

While selecting his team, Shastri picked the stand-in captain KL Rahul and CSK opener Ruturaj Gaikwad as openers and also went on to include Hardik Pandya, who had an outstanding IPL 2022, where he not only led the Gujarat Titans to a memorable title triumph but also showcased his all-round abilities by making the bat and the ball do the talking.

I think they will go with the guys they will want to see first: Ravi Shastri

“I think they will go with the guys they will want to see first – the Rahuls, the Ruturaj Gaikwads – maybe they will open. They will probably give Ishan (Kishan) a break in this game or bat him at three,” Shastri was quoted as saying on Star Sports show ‘Game Plan’.

“If you bat him (Ishan) at three, then it will be Shreyas (Iyer) at No. 4, (Rishabh) Pant at No. 5, and Hardik (Pandya) at No. 6,” he stated.

In the bowling department, the ex-all-rounder picked the likes of Axar Patel, Bhuvneshwar Kumar, Yuzvendra Chahal, and was spoiled for choices between Arshdeep Singh and Umran Malik and completed the list by picking medium-pacer Harshal Patel.

The selectors have decided to rest the key players including the likes of Rohit Sharma, Virat Kohli, and Jasprit Bumrah as a part of the workload management, taking a jam-packed calendar into consideration that also includes the Asia Cup, and the T20 World Cup in Australia. The Men in Blue would be eager to avenge the away ODI series whitewash against the Proteas earlier this year.

Ravi Shastri’s XI: KL Rahul, Ruturaj Gaikwad, Ishan Kishan, Shreyas Iyer, Rishabh Pant, Hardik Pandya, Axar Patel, Bhuvneshwar Kumar, Yuzvendra Chahal, Arshdeep Singh/Umran Malik, Harshal Patel.
